**Ticket: Retention sweeper config drift on prod-east**

Hey — flagging this for your review since it touches retention guarantees. The Dunwold sweeper on prod-east has drifted from what's in the repo: someone hand-edited the node config back in spring and it never got reconciled, so the sweep interval and grace window there don't match the other regions. Nothing got retained longer than policy allows as far as we can tell, but you should verify. For reference, the repo says the sweeper should be running with these values.

deployment values, kajep-kageg:
[praix]
host = praix.paliqcorp.corp
user = praix_svc
database = praix_prod

Team,

Effective Monday, responsibility for the blue-green deployment pipeline of the LedgerSpin billing worker is moving off the platform rotation. This covers the cutover scripts, the traffic-shifting checks, and rollback verification in the Quartzline staging cluster. Reviewers should route any pipeline-affecting changes to the new owner for approval before merge; existing open reviews will be reassigned this week. The person now accountable for all of this is named below.

approver of bagug-bagag = Holael Pramir

Key ceremony checklist — crash-report pipeline (for plugin authors)

Hey folks — before your Snapfern plugin ships, make sure crash reports from your code route through the shared pipeline, not your own endpoint. Symbols get uploaded at ceremony time and sealed alongside our signing keys, so double-check your build uploads them. Once sealed, re-opening the symbol store needs the ceremony quorum. For the test environment only, you can unseal it yourself with the passphrase below.

unlock words, hahip-baduf: holwyn-istath-julvan